Shooting Near Club Wounds 2

Prince George's County police are investigating a shooting near a Forestville nightclub that wounded two men yesterday.

The incident occurred about 3:15 a.m. at a gas station near Forestville Road and Marlboro Pike.

Multiple shots were fired from a 9mm handgun at several people who stopped at the gas station after leaving the CFE nightclub in the 7700 block of Forestville Road, said Prince George's police spokesman Cpl. Stephen Pacheco.

Bullets struck two men, ages 20 and 23, in their arms and shattered the windows of a nearby vehicle, Pacheco said.

The men, whose names were not released yesterday, were treated at a hospital for injuries not considered to be life-threatening.
